Brandson - Sound level meter calibrated - Digital volume meter - 35dB to 130dB with LCD display with backlight - Noise meter - MAX/MIN data storage

Product Features
- Is the volume tolerable or already too high? What one still perceives as reasonable is no longer acceptable for the other. To find a common language here, objective readings help. This is exactly what the Brandson sound level meter delivers with high precision. When delivered, the device is already calibrated correctly. | 304418
- The sound level meter delivers precise readings with a resolution of 0.1 dB over a wide volume range - from whispers to rock concerts. Frequencies from 32 hertz (subwoofer, church organ) up to 8 kHz (birdsong, and higher) are recorded. The accuracy is in the range of +/- 1.5 dB. A protective cap on the measuring microphone shields wind noise.
- With the MAX function, the last determined maximum value is displayed during the period of a measurement. For example, at a construction site you can determine how high the maximum load is within your measurement period. "Hold" fixes the last measured value for you.
- The large display makes reading the readings an easy thing even on the extended arm. In dark environments, you can turn on a display lighting.
- An inch thread on the back allows a professional measuring setup using a tripod. After ten minutes of non-use, the device switches off to save the batteries (3 x AAA batteries already included).
